The fox ticker said "unregistered ammunition" whatever that means.
Washington DC Ammo Laws state..............
In general, a person shall not possess ammunition within the District unless: He is a licensed dealer. He is a holder of a valid registration certificate for a firearm. ... He temporarily possesses ammunition while participating in a firearms training and safety class conducted by a firearms instructor.
